The link describes forwarding the spam email to Citibank, where in turn, the complaint itself was blocked due to the content containing spam. Other replies describe going to the Citibank web site looking for complaint emails, and then finding those emails don't work.

I found what I think is an interesting tidbit while perusing thru email specifications (SMTP). Email server implementations MUST support the user "POSTMASTER" as a valid address, thus being a reliable receptacle for email for any email domain. On the other hand, this could be implemented as a "write-only" dead letter office, but you can be reasonably certain the email won't bounce and the address will be valid without looking anything up.
